How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Gibson?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Gibson Studio Apartments | $1,217 | $950 | $2,000 |
Gibson 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,240 | $825 | $2,276 |
Gibson 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,460 | $825 | $2,400 |
Gibson 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,801 | $1,120 | $2,583 |
Gibson 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,801 | $1,100 | $2,100 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gibson
How much are Studio apartments in Gibson?
There are currently 5 Studio Apartments in Gibson with rent ranges from $950 to $2,000 with an average price of $1,217.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Gibson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Gibson ranges from $825 to $2,276 with an average monthly rent of $1,240.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Gibson c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Gibson range from $825 to $2,400.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,460.
How expensive are Gibson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 21 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Gibson on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,120 to $2,583 - averaging $1,801 for the location.
